VSA Activation Indicator Does Not Come On At Start-Up (Bulb Check)




VSA activation indicator does not come on at start-up (bulb check)

Diagnostic Procedure:

1. Do the gauge control module troubleshooting. Reading and Clearing Diagnostic Trouble Codes

2. Substitute a known-good VSA modulator-control unit, then retest. If it is OK, replace the original VSA modulator-control unit. Service and Repair
